Introducing Relationship Status on DOWN

When creating a new account, you’ll now be asked a simple question:

“What’s your relationship status right now?”

You can choose the option that best reflects your current situation:

  • Single
  • Couple
  • Restarting after a breakup
  • Situationships
  • Ethical Open Relationships
  • Prefer not to say

Because modern dating looks different for everyone, we wanted to offer options that reflect real life relationship experiences, not just traditional labels.

Whether you’re newly single, part of a couple, navigating a situationship, or exploring an ethical open relationship, your profile should be able to reflect where you’re at right now.
